Heading into a Warm and Mostly Dry Pattern

Summary

Memorial Day weekend is shaping up to be beautiful with warmer temps and more sunshine. A slight chance of t-storms will exist Sat-Sun, but it's a marginal setup so we may end up with nothing. Somewhat higher t-storm chances arrive Mon thru the middle of next week, but rainfall potential looks sparse. Overall, warmer & drier than normal conditions are expected for the end of May & early June.
